Call a general election now says Annette Mooney, People Before Profit
The Taoiseach, Brain Cowen, should step down immediately and call a general election, says People Before Profit candidate in Dublin South East, Annette Mooney.
“It is clear to anyone now that not only do the people not want Brian Cowen as their leader, his own party members don’t want him,” said Annette, who is standing as part of the United Left Alliance.
“Cowen is hanging on like a gasping, dying animal and he should put his party and the country out of their misery and succumb to the inevitable. This consultation process with his party that he’s now insisting is a pathetic attempt to buy time for Fianna Fail and their discredited policies. The people don’t want any of them.”
Annette is calling on Cowen to finally show some leadership the people can respect, and step down. Call an election now.
